Abstract
The invention belongs to the technical field of plant cultivation, and provides a production method of selenium-rich high-quality honeysuckle. The production method comprises the following steps of: mixing farmyard manure and sodium selenite, and applying the mixture onto a root part of the honeysuckle when in budding dates of the honeysuckle; adding rare earth micronutrients, sodium selenite, sodium hydrogen sulfite and surface active agent into water, stirring and dissolving, and spraying the dissolved mixture onto leaf surfaces when in honeysuckle flourishing period and bud stage; and airing the collected honeysuckle to obtain a honeysuckle product. Due to a rear earth-amino acid binary coordination compound, the function of a plant growth regulator is achieved; the content of heavy metal ion is reduced; the contents of effective component chlorogenic acid and galuteolin are improved; the yield and the quality of the honeysuckle are improved further; and the sodium hydrogen sulfite provides an acid environment for the honeysuckle, so that the absorption on selenium elements is promoted. The production method of the selenium-rich high-quality honeysuckle adopts a biotransformation method so as to transform inorganic selenium to organic selenium; solves the problem that the honeysuckle produced by a traditional planting method only contains basic effective components, so as not to reach the aim of supplement of selenium after being eaten; and can be used for batch production of the honeysuckle.

Background technology
Selenium is the essential micronutrient elements of animals and humans.The international selenium recommendation daily intaking amount 60-400 μ g of association, daily intaking amount 50-200 μ g recommends in Chinese Soclety of Nutrition.And according to China's nutrition survey, the only 26-32 μ g of selenium intake being grown up every day.Therefore, population of China selemium nutrition is bad is universal phenomenon, and China lacks selenium soil and accounts for the whole nation 72%, lacks selenium population and reaches more than 100,000,000.
Science is verified now, selenium has the effect of 400 various diseases such as anti-cancer, anticancer, control cardiovascular and cerebrovascular disease, hepatopathy, diabetes, gynaecological disease, prostate and cataract, have anti-oxidant, remove interior free yl improve immunity, many specific functions delay senility, go down and aging course etc. as cardiovascular and cerebrovascular disease, cancer, diabetes, body immunity, all relevant with scarce selenium.And in the day by day serious situation of environmental pollution, selenium has the special physiological functions such as the heavy metal poisoning of releasing.Therefore, human body is mended selenium and is not only the requirement that improves immunity, is also the effective way that strengthens the resistance to environmental poisonous substance; Selenium in natural food can not meet the normal need of human body, and economic, healthy, safe selenium-enriched food is the effective way that the mankind mend selenium.Animal is mended sodium selenite for selenium and adds and food in the past, but its biological effectiveness is low, and takes in narrow range, easily produces excess intake and poisoning problem, and rich by reference selenium Lonicera flower tea can be when leisure be had tea easy to do Selenium Supplement element.
Studies confirm that, rare earth element does not belong to the nutritive element of plant, it is mainly that rare earth belongs to physiologically active of plant material that Rational Application rare earth impels the reason of increasing crop yield and high-quality, there is the function of regulating plant body physiological activity, can promote the absorption of crops to nutrients such as nitrogen, phosphorus, potassium, increase the chloroplast content of plant, improve intensity of photosynthesis, promote enzymic activity, promote crop floral organ to grow, early flowering, suitable rare earth concentration can promote seed germination to promote seed germination and root growth, reduce the crop incidence of disease, strengthen the anti-adversity ability of crop.Rare earth is residual little, is a kind of important plant growth regulator being worthy to be popularized.Therefore, someone thinks that rare earth application has been most important application and development since rare earth is found 200 years.
In recent years, along with going deep into of rare earth application theory and practice, people start rare earth element for Chinese herbal medicine, to improving Chinese herbal medicine quantity and quality, improve the content of Chinese herbal medicine effective ingredients undoubtedly, finally improve curative effect of medication, have opened up new way.Research shows to use rare earth on Chinese herbal medicine, can promote root growth, stratification, reduce disease, improve emergence rate, and accelerate seedling and grow tall and increase slightly, improve chlorophyll content, promotion nitrogen, phosphorus, potassium absorption, improve soluble sugar content and amino acid whose content, improve quality, strengthen plant resistance.Use the trophic level that rare earth can obviously improve Chinese herbal medicine, promote growing of plant, increase dry-matter accumulation and chlorophyll content, obviously reduce fruit drop.

Embodiment 1:
The present invention is a kind of method of producing rich selenium, good quality and high output honeysuckle, the first step: first in the time of the sprouting period fertilising of honeysuckle, after adopting farmyard manure and sodium selenite to mix, execute at honeysuckle root, farmyard manure mixes with sodium selenite by dry with poultry, livestock or people's ight soil, and the weight ratio of farmyard manure and sodium selenite is: farmyard manure: sodium selenite=100: 0.005; Fertilising consumption is the every pier of 3kg/; Farmyard manure is natural material, can provide required nutriment for the growth of gold and silver flower seedling, but mix with sodium selenite after must being dried, otherwise the soluble loss of sodium selenite;
The mixture of farmyard manure and sodium selenite is executed and is embedded in topsoil 20cm, spreads thin soil above and covers.The soluble moisture in soil of sodium selenite, and be easy to flow away downwards, crops seedling stage, spreading thin soil covering is above the effect of playing isolated air, avoids oxidized.
Second step, prosperous long-term honeysuckle, should strengthen benefit selenium, and regulate with rare earth-amino acid plant growth regulator.Taking RE microbial fertilizer as carrier, add sodium selenite, sodium hydrogensulfite, with 10 parts of weight ratio RE microbial fertilizer, sodium selenite 0.001-0.04 part, sodium hydrogensulfite 0.05-0.2 part is mixed, and mixed fertilizer joins temperature 20-50 DEG C, and weight ratio is in the water of 100 parts, and adding organic surface active agent stirring and dissolving, the mixed liquor of dissolving carries out liquid level sprinkling.RE microbial fertilizer is laboratory preparation, wherein, and N: P
2o
5: K
2the weight ratio of O is 20: 10: 10, then adds rare earth-amino acid two-element match La (Gly)
4cl
33H
2o;
Selenium element is more difficult by liquid level absorptance, need to repeatedly spray, but selenium element is easier to be absorbed by plants under sour environment, and sodium hydrogensulfite can provide weak sour environment, can promote the absorption of crop to selenium; Rare earth-amino acid two-element match La (Gly)
4cl
33H
2the synthetic method of O: take a certain amount of La
2o
3solid, is dissolved in HCl, allow it fully react and in water-bath slow evaporation to dry, then with acetone washing, be placed on and in NaOH drier, be dried to constant weight and make LaCl
3hydrate.Accurately take 1mmoL LaCl
3hydrate, adds 25mL absolute ethyl alcohol, under stirring, drips wherein the aqueous solution 3mL of 4mmoL glycine, stirs suction filtration after 0.5 hour, with ethanol washing, is dried to constant weight and makes complex on silica gel.By analysis must this two-element match consist of La (Gly)
4cl
33H
2o.
Sodium selenite, rare earth-amino acid two-element match fertilizer, sodium hydrogensulfite are mixed in proportion, be dissolved in the water of 20-50 DEG C, and add a certain amount of organic surface active agent, honeysuckle is implemented to liquid level and spray.
The 3rd step, the rice flower bud phase sprays: in the rice flower bud phase of honeysuckle, be sprayed on honeysuckle by the mixed liquor of preparing in step b.
In the operation of second step and the 3rd step, when sprinkling, the choosing cloudy day, or after fine day at 4 o'clock in afternoon, spray in latter 24 hours, in case of rainy, fill spray 1 time.
After above-mentioned steps is processed, honeysuckle is dried and gets product after gathering.
Through above-mentioned steps honeysuckle product after treatment, wherein Se content is 786 μ g/kg after measured, and chlorogenic acid and galuteolin content increase respectively 5-15% than untreated sample, and output increases 5-22%.

By above method, with containing 30mgL
-1glycine lanthanum process Pingyi pan honeysuckle flower (mountain honeysuckle flower), can adopt following methods to carry out the mensuration of chlorogenic acid and galuteolin content.
The mensuration of chlorogenic acid:
Chromatographic condition: taking octadecylsilane chemically bonded silica as filler, taking acetonitrile-0.4% phosphoric acid solution (13: 87) as mobile phase, detecting 327nm, is the characteristic peak of 17.9min place for chlorogenic acid in retention time.
The preparation of need testing solution: the about 0.5g of extracting honeysuckle powder (crossing sieve No. four), accurately weighed, put in tool plug conical flask, precision adds 50% methyl alcohol 50mL, weighed weight, ultrasonic processing (power 250w, frequency 35Hz) 30min, let cool, more weighed weight, the weight of supplying less loss with 50% methyl alcohol, shakes up, and filters, precision measures subsequent filtrate 5mL, puts in 25mL brown bottle, adds 50% methyl alcohol to scale, shake up, to obtain final product.The accurate reference substance 10 μ L that draw respectively, injection liquid chromatography, measures, and to obtain final product.Recording without the Chlorogenic Acid of Flos Lonicerae content of glycine lanthanum processing is 2.12%, through containing 30mgL
-1the Chlorogenic Acid of Flos Lonicerae content of glycine lanthanum processing be 2.34%, increased by 10.38% than contrast.
The mensuration of galuteolin:
Chromatographic condition: taking octadecylsilane chemically bonded silica as filler, taking acetonitrile as mobile phase A, taking 0.5% glacial acetic acid solution as Mobile phase B, press 0-30min, mobile phase A: 10%-30%, Mobile phase B: 90%-70% carries out gradient elution, and detection wavelength is 350nm.Be the characteristic peak that 48.1min place is galuteolin in retention time.
The preparation of need testing solution: the about 3g of extracting honeysuckle fine powder (crossing sieve No. four), accurately weighed, put in tool plug conical flask, precision adds 70% ethanol 50mL, weighed weight, ultrasonic processing (power 250w, frequency 35kHz) 1 hour, let cool, more weighed weight, supply the weight of less loss with 70% ethanol, shake up, filter, get subsequent filtrate, to obtain final product.The accurate need testing solution 10 μ L that draw, injection liquid chromatography, measures, and to obtain final product.Recording without galuteolin content in the honeysuckle of glycine lanthanum processing is 0.14%, through containing 30mgL
-1the honeysuckle of glycine lanthanum processing in galuteolin content be 0.16%, increased by 14.28% than contrast.
